U100 Writeups 2009

U100 Southeast Sophomore 09 MVPS

ATLANTA GA  10TH  grade Ultimate 100 Outstanding Performance List

Kadetrix Marcus

Hillgrove HS, GA

10th

S #6

Mark down Marcus as a future star after winning Overall MVP. At 5’11 175, Marcus exploded onto the scene with a 36.5 inch vertical, 8’6 broad jump, 4.51 shuttle run and lock down abilities during 1 on 1 drills. Marcus is the type of player that player that will generate interest anywhere he goes.

Rachard Pippens

Ola HS, GA

10th

CB #63

Pippens, 6’0 174, was crowned Combine King after posting unbelievable all around numbers. With a Lebron James like 34.5 inch vertical, 10’10 broad jump, ran a 4.45 40 and bench pressed 185 lbs 15 times. Pippens’ athleticism is second to none.

Shaun Ward

Boyd Anderson HS, FL

10th

DL #88

Ward, 6’1 223, was the Big Man Combine King. Ward had a 26 inch vertical, 8’6 broad jump, ran a 4.65 shuttle, and an outstanding 4.58 40, which is unheard of for a lineman. Ward’s traits for a lineman are very unique.

Brett Charron

South Forsyth HS, GA

10th

LB #76

Charron, 5’9.5 220, was the Strongest Man. Charron bench pressed 155 lbs an outstanding 44 times. Charron also had an 8’4 broad jump and ran a 4.42 shuttle. With world class strength and good speed, Charron is a monster of the midway.

Andrew Buie

Trinity Christian HS, FL

10th

RB #21

Buie, 5’9 181, was the RB MVP. With a 30 inch vertical, 9’3 broad jump, 4.58 40, 20 reps at 155 lbs on the bench press and outstanding skill during 1 on 1 drills, Buie will be a big time star.

Justin Osking

John Carroll HS, FL

10th

QB #47

Osking was named QB MVP. Osking, 6’3 232 had great fundamentals, throwing passes in the perfect spot while making intelligent choices throughout the 1 on 1 drills. Osking also bench pressed 155 lbs 25 times.

Kyle Champion

Americus Sumter HS, GA

10th

TE #90

What a fitting name! At 6’3.5 242, Kyle came out a champion after being named TE MVP. Champion had a 26.5 inch vertical, bench pressed 155 lbs 19 times and made a handful of tough grabs during 1 on 1’s.

Deon Meadows

Smyrna HS, TN

10th

LB #62

After being awarded LB MVP, there is a new Deon that is can be referred to as prime time. At 5’10.5 201, Meadows had a 31 inch vertical, 9’3 broad jump, ran a 4.52 shuttle, 4.59 40, bench pressed 155 lbs 23 times and was a stud during 1 on 1’s.

Keith Brent

Marvin Ridge HS, NC

10th

WR #48

A lanky 6’3 171 lber, Brent was the WR MVP. Brent had a 29 inch vertical, 8’7 broad jump and ran exceptional routes during 1 on 1’s.

Jeremy Reynolds

James B Dudley HS, NC

10th

CB #41

Reynolds, 5’8.5 169, was the winner of the Dodie award. Reynolds had a 35 inch vertical, 9’9 broad jump, ran a 4.36 shuttle and bench pressed 155 lbs 15 times. Reynolds’ athleticism makes him an exciting player to watch.

Monte Golden

Northside HS, NC

10th

OL #99

The winner of the OL MVP and Leadership award, it is only fitting that this 6’1 280 lb standout has a surname of Golden. Golden worked hard throughout the combine, leading his group by example. During 1 on 1’s, Golden kept the d-linemen in check and also bench pressed 185 lbs 20 times.

Harmon Brown

Boyd H. Anderson

10th

CB #16

Brown, 5’7.5 155, was the Fastest Man and DB MVP. A lockdown defensive back, Brown ran a 4.43 in the shuttle as well as the 40 and had an 8’5 broad jump. Getting a catch against Brown will be a tough task for most receivers.

Jonathan Battle

Americus Sumter HS, GA

10th

DL #56

After battling it out with the top linemen in the region, Jonathan was the DL MVP as well as Strongest Man. The 6’0 280 lb Battle bench pressed 185 lbs 33 times, had a 29 inch vertical, 8’1 broad jump and was dominant during 1 on 1 drills. Battle is ready for war!
